100% of this may not be true, I'm just typing what I've been told the past two weeks, enjoy the story.. Not a happy ending.

November 28 - RapidSpeeds servers went down (Probably wrong date...)
November 29 - BoxSlots received 25 orders the next day.
November 30 - BoxSlots received 35 orders & sold out.
December 1 - BoxSlots received 40 orders & sold out once again.
December 2 - Tickets were being answered & everything started to go back to normal (sold out)
December 3 - BoxSlots was taken down by a jealous competitor. (Hacked) Nearly 30 clients left.
^ 80 hour work week :(

December 4 - All nighter, setup 300 VPS's & started performing over installs, tickets, etc. (30 hours straight no sleep :( )

December 5 - Still performing installs, tickets, charge-backs, etc.
December 6 - Everything was slowly going back to normal, only a couple of tickets left.
December 7 - BoxSlots was once again hacked by a jealous competitor.
^^ 3 hours a sleep each night.. healthy huh? Bad customer service my ass...

December 8 - Once again, setup 250 VPS's, installs, answering tickets & dealing with more charge backs.
December 9 - Nearly every penny was spent on security, upgrades, server maintenance, etc...
December 10 - Tickets, installs, charge-backs, normal day after being hacked..
December 11 - Xen was upgraded to a better control panel & was hoping for auto-reinstall to be done by the end of the week.
December 12 - Tickets & xen work...

December 13, 2011 - During the day, the jealous competitor somehow hacked into our systems & started re-installing our client's servers. Solus was taken offline to prevent this from happening to the remaining clients. During the day, rk's internet was taken down, so he had no way in helping the situation (tickets were not answered, due to the fact, I don't have access to refunding the payments, solus, etc...).

Financially, BoxSlots cannot go on, due to the charge-backs, hacking, & security improvements (I guess they didn't work huh?)

Reputation, we provided a service with decent support & services, only thing that makes us look bad is the hacking... Overall we were a great company.

Anyway this is a review on Boxslots. (An Honest one)

I joined Boxslots back in July 2011. I was very happy and more than satisfied with the performance their vps offered with the price tag. I think its the best you can get. I had their Started VPS with 100mbit dedicated port. Most of the time speed topped 60M/s. I do not know how is that possible but yes it did and still does.

On 12/3/2011 I ordered my 2nd VPS of the same kind and before it could get deployed. Their entire system went down because of WHMCS bug. For a day or two I was still under impression that its a glitch in their system. I saw a brand new VPS in my account and thought they mistakenly deleted my other VPS which I had with them for few months. Later that day I found out that they got hacked because of WHMCS bug which was beyond their control. I was EXTREMELY pissed because I had over 300GB worth of Data on that VPS. The only backup I had for that was on my Home PC. Imagine uploading 300GB from your home computer. (Yup pain in the rear end)

I instantly wanted to cry like a baby as soon as I realized that I lost everything on that server and it was never going to come back. I decided to move to a different provider thinking that if a company gets hit with something like this, it is unlikely that they will ever come back. Mainly because it is hard to start from scratch, they lost many customers including me because of that.

I opened a ticket, that got wiped out I guess because they restored their old database for client area. I thought they were playing with me and wouldn't like to answer my ticket. I opened another one, and this time got a reply with the explanation. At first I didn't want to hear a word other than compensation for what I lost. Then I realized it must be hard for them to deal with this, So i just simply asked for a refund on my new server which was never deployed. I didn;t expect anything more than that, but amazingly Rickie offered me a partial refund on the VPS that I had with them for the days left on invoice. I still didn't want to stay with them so I moved on.
For next few days I tried 2 different hosts, both of them are here on Wjuction and I will not name them. Both were laggy, and didn't suit my needs. In the mean time I got back in touch with Boxslots and found out that they are back in business. It really shocked me, to be honest if i was the owner of Boxslots, I would have ran away and started a new company. But no, Boxslots did come back and tried their best to fix the issues.
I know it took them a while to fix everything and yes tickets were delayed. But you all need to realize that what the went through is not normal in any way.

Now, I am back with them and have partially been back on track. Thanks to my home internet connection of 50Mbps. Otherwise it would have been impossible to get back with my business this soon.

All I am saying is, whatever happened was a huge loss for all of us (including Boxslots). Boxslots probably lost many customers but I am sticking with them because they showed an effort to come back and make things right for their customers.

My server is back to normal for couple of days now and everything is running smoothly. On 100mbits dedicated my server downloads at 60M/s for most of the time. I don't see many hosts offering this kind of service.

My request to boxslots is that please make sure nothing like this happens in future. I will hate you with passion if I have to upload 300GB worth of data once again lol.

Other than that, its all good :) My support is with you, mainly because you tried your best to make things right for your customers.
